"The U.S. Army future robotic army is taking shape faster, and better, than some officials expected.

"There's a lot of excitement in industry, in the Army, and we've seen industry ahead of our timeline a little bit," Brig. Gen. Richard Ross Coffman, director of the Next Generation Combat Vehicle Cross Functional Team, told Breaking Defense reporter Sydney Freedberg, Jr. "We are adjusting our expectations."…"
